What McDonough Homeowners Should Keep in Mind
Outdoor conditions in McDonough can be tough on yards, hardscapes, and drainage systems. Whether you’re maintaining an older property or planning updates, these are a few things worth knowing:
Here are a few helpful things to keep in mind:
Standing Water Signals a Drainage Issue
If water collects in your yard after heavy rain, it is often a sign of poor grading or drainage. Many landscaping services in McDonough include French drains or surface regrading to help move water away from structures, common solutions used by local landscaping companies in McDonough to prevent long-term damage.
Sod Can Offer a Faster Reset Than Seeding
When a lawn becomes patchy or bare, installing sod may be more effective than seeding. In McDonough, professional landscapers often recommend this option for homeowners seeking fast, reliable ground cover as part of their lawn care and landscaping plan. Sod gives immediate results and helps with erosion control.
Retaining Walls Support Sloped Areas
Sloped yards often need retaining walls to manage erosion and hold soil in place. Many commercial landscaping services and residential landscaping services include wall installation as a practical solution for McDonough's hilly terrain. This form of hardscaping service adds structural support and is especially useful in areas with runoff.
Site Grading Impacts More Than Appearance—Uneven ground can lead to drainage problems, trip hazards, and construction delays. Proper grading improves water flow and prepares land for features like patios or sod. It's a standard step in many landscaping services near me, ensuring the site is safe, functional, and ready for future garden design and installation.

Residential Landscaping
Services in McDonough
Landscaping for homes in McDonough often means working with Georgia clay, heavy rain, and seasonal changes. Whether the goal is to improve curb appeal or solve drainage issues, residential landscaping requires attention to both function and upkeep. Here's what most homeowners should consider:
Lawn and Plant Care
Regular mowing, pruning, and seasonal cleanup help keep yards healthy. Sod installation is often used when grass is patchy or won't take to seeding.
Drainage and Grading
Many yards in the area suffer from pooling water or erosion. Proper grading and simple drainage solutions help protect your home's foundation and keep outdoor areas usable.
Hardscaping and Design
Patios, walkways, and retaining walls are common additions that improve how the yard is used. These elements also help manage slopes and support long-term landscape structure.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What types of residential landscaping services are common in McDonough?
Most homeowners in McDonough need a mix of lawn care, yard cleanup, drainage solutions, grading, sod installation, and hardscaping. These services help manage Georgia’s clay soil, heavy rain, and fast-growing vegetation.
2. How do I know if my yard needs grading or drainage work?
If you notice standing water, erosion, or soggy areas after rain, it’s worth having the grading checked. Many landscaping services in McDonough include drainage assessments to prevent long-term damage to your lawn or foundation.
3. Can sod be installed year-round in McDonough?
Sod can be installed in most seasons, but spring and early fall offer the best results. Local landscaping companies often recommend these windows for optimal rooting, especially given the region’s heat and heavy rainfall.
4. What are the benefits of adding hardscaping to a residential yard?
Hardscaping—like patios, retaining walls, and walkways—improves how you use your outdoor space. In McDonough, it also helps manage sloped yards and reduces erosion from frequent rain.
5. How often should I schedule landscape maintenance for my home?
Most lawn care and landscaping plans in McDonough follow a seasonal schedule, with routine mowing, pruning, and cleanup every few weeks. Regular maintenance keeps the yard healthy and prevents small issues from becoming larger repairs.
